#034f13 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#034f13 is composed of 1.2% red, 31%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.9%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 132.6 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 16.1%. #034f13 color hex could be obtained by blending #069e26 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

Shades and Tints of #034f13

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#f0fef3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#034f13

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#292929 is the less saturated color, while #034f13 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#034f13 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#313131 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#28372b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#554d1c Protanopia 1% of men
  • #5e4925 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#2a5258 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#374d18 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#3d4b1e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#1c513f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
